Pollution Characteristics and Application of River Sediment of the Western Nakdong River

Abstract
|
|
|
The pollution characteristics of water and river sediment were studied through the water quality analysis and the heavy metal analysis of river sediment in the Western Nakdong river, and then a commercial tile using the polluted sediment was produced. The analytical results of the riverbed structure and the depth distribution in the Western Nakdong river were that Macdo Stream(site 2) was the deepest(13 ft). The analytical result of water quality showed that BOD was the highest in the Hogei Stream(site 6); COD, Suanduengchi Island(site 1); SS, Macdo Stream(site 2); T-N, Suanduengchi Island(site 1); T-P, Macdo Stream(site 2). Therefore the deeper the site was the higher the pollution concentration was. The result of heavy metal analysis of the river sediment was that Pb and Cr were the highest in Kangdong Bridge(site 9); Cd, Macdo Stream(site 2), so the deeper the site was the higher the pollution concentration was. The production of tile using the mixture of the polluted sediment and the raw material was successful, so the reuse of polluted sediment was possible.
